About this role

Herpetology Undergraduate Collections Assistant - Student Hourly

Job Description: 50% - Collections & Data Management • Assist Curators to ensure long-term integrity and preservation of the physical collections, associated data, and collection-storage environment. • Participate in the monitoring of status and organization of the fluid, tissue, and dry collections. • Help maintain collection database; digitize specimen data, records, and information. • Maintain collection-care protocols • Process specimen loans, exchanges, and gifts; maintain appropriate digital records of these activities. • Participate in annual reviews of outstanding specimen loans, specimen return reminders and recalls of overdue loans. 50% - Collection Acquisition • Work with Curators to organize and prepare specimens to be accessioned and cataloged in the collection. • Work with Curators on the staging of newly accessioned specimens and the digital capture of associated data for their integration into the collection and collection database, respectively.
